Press Junketeer Posts: 410 Joined: 11 Jul 2009 | So far most RTS's are all designed around the concept of micro management. It's always been an integral part of the genre, especially in competitive play. The problem is you cant really micro on a console. You need to have the mouse and hotkeys to be able to quickly micro your units. IT just doesn't work on consoles. That said, there is one console RTS which actually does a pretty good job on it. Brutal Legend. It actually circumvents the micro problem by mixing in action elements into the gameplay. If your not familiar with it, basically you control your hero unit as you would in an action game, and then give orders to your army. You can do special attacks and buffs etc. Interesting bit is you can take control of individual units in double team attacks, essentially letting you micro that unit... it works really well, and essentially keeps the traditional macro management elements from RTS's, capturing resources, building units, "select all, attack move" type stuff, and substitutes the micro elements with action elements... |
